Created by James Westby and last modified
Get this branch:
bzr branch lp:debian/pulseaudio
Members of Ubuntu branches can upload to this branch. Log in for directions.

Related bugs

Related blueprints

Branch information

Ubuntu branches

Recent revisions

52. By Felipe Sateler

[ Luke Yelavich ]
* New upstream release
* Dropped patch, applied upstream
* Update shlibs file for 7.0

[ Felipe Sateler ]
* Update bash completion lintian override
* Upload to unstable

51. By Felipe Sateler

Module udev detect is linux-only, so don't install on !linux.

50. By Felipe Sateler

Specify systemd user unit dir explicitly.
The pkgconfig file lives in package systemd, which we don't want to
build-depend on.

49. By Felipe Sateler

* Do not build bluez4 module, it is no longer available.
  Closes: #788293
* Pass --disable-hal-compat to configure instead of building a module we do
  not install
* Use dh-exec instead of manual .install mangling
* Do not use dh_installman to install manpages, upstream already installs
  them correctly.
* libpulse-dev: drop Depends on libavahi-client-dev
* debian/rules: use DEB_DH_INSTALL_SOURCEDIR instead of deprecated DEB_DH_INSTALL_ARGS
* Install (but not enable) systemd user units on linux archs.
  Closes: #794226

48. By Felipe Sateler

* Pick upstream patch that creates a localised version of pa_yes_no
  - This fixes a problem when that function was used to create module
    loading arguments.
* Upload to unstable

47. By Felipe Sateler

* Replace raop channels patch with proper fix from upstream.
* Release to unstable.

46. By Felipe Sateler

Fix gnu-kfreebsd.patch typo (missing !)

45. By Felipe Sateler

* Fix #defines for Debian GNU/kFreeBSD. Closes: #756914
* debian/patches/kfreebsd_no_lock_and_threads_synchro.patch: mark as applied

44. By Felipe Sateler

* Revert enabling of testsuite.
  - Fails on multiple architectures, so disable while we work things out

43. By Felipe Sateler

[ Felipe Sateler ]
* Drop workaround for ARM < v6, upstream now conditionally compiles it.
* Drop special patches rule, not used anymore
* debian/patches/0003-exit-with-X-session.patch
  - Kill pulseaudio on session exit with kde too
  - Add DEP-3 header, forwarded
* Enable testsuite
* Bump debhelper compat level to 9
  - debug symbols are now stored by build-id instead of by path
  - Exclude private libpulsecommon-5.0.so from dh_makeshlibs
* Change init script dependency from avahi to avahi-daemon. Closes: #731609
  - Requires adding a Breaks on avahi-daemon << 0.6.31-3
* Bump standards-version (No changes needed)
* Add lintian override for pulseaudio package
  - bash completion is not meant to be executable
  - neither are the pulseaudio configuration files
* Do not start pulseaudio in X session if it was already started.
   Closes: #743813
* Remove pulseaudio init script, place it under examples.
   Closes: #696842
* debian/patches/only-autostart-kde-version.patch:
   - Do not autostart pulseaudio twice under KDE, it sometimes leads
     to slow system startup. Closes: #705426
* debian/patches/rtp-recv-fix-crash-on-empty-UDP-packets-CVE-2014-397.patch
   - New patch from upstream, fixes crash on empty UDP packets.
     Fixes CVE-2014-397
* zsh-completion: Fix completion for default sink/source
* Add bugscript to the pulseaudio package. Closes: #739294
* Make pulseaudio Depend on pulseaudio-utils
  - start-pulseaudio{kde,x11} needs it. Closes: #648973
  - The bugscript needs it too.
* Use dh_lintian instead of manually installing overrides

[ Jelmer Vernooij ]
* Disable building against tdb on the hurd, where it is not available.
   Closes: #749333

Branch metadata

Branch format:
Branch format 7
Repository format:
Bazaar repository format 2a (needs bzr 1.16 or later)
Stacked on:
This branch contains Public information 
Everyone can see this information.